1. Lack of Human Interaction

One of the primary concerns surrounding AI in education is the potential erosion of human interaction. Traditional education thrives on the teacher-student relationship, where educators provide not only knowledge but also mentorship, support, and emotional connection. AI-driven education tools, such as intelligent tutors or chatbots, may replace human teachers to a certain extent. While these tools can be effective for delivering content and assessing performance, they lack the emotional intelligence and empathy that human teachers bring to the classroom.

In a world increasingly reliant on AI for education, students might miss out on valuable social and emotional learning opportunities. Interpersonal skills, collaboration, and empathy are essential life skills that cannot be fully cultivated in an AI-driven environment. Moreover, students might become isolated, leading to loneliness and mental health issues.

2. Data Privacy Concerns

The use of AI in education often involves the collection and analysis of vast amounts of student data. This data includes everything from academic performance to personal information and behavioral patterns. While AI can use this data to personalize learning experiences, it also raises significant privacy concerns.

The mishandling or misuse of student data can have serious consequences. Data breaches can expose sensitive information, leading to identity theft or other malicious activities. Additionally, the constant monitoring of students’ online behavior raises questions about surveillance and the potential for abuse. Who has access to this data, how it is stored, and how long it is retained are all questions that need to be addressed to ensure the protection of students’ privacy.

3. Reinforcing Biases

AI systems learn from the data they are trained on, which means they can inherit and even amplify biases present in the data. In the context of education, this can have significant negative implications. If the AI systems used for assessment, grading, or recommendation are trained on biased historical data, they may perpetuate and reinforce existing inequalities.

For example, an AI-powered admissions system that is trained on historical admission data could inadvertently discriminate against underrepresented minority groups. Similarly, AI-driven educational content recommendations might inadvertently steer students towards subjects and career paths that align with prevailing stereotypes.

4. Standardization of Learning

AI-driven education systems often aim to standardize learning experiences and outcomes. While standardization can help identify areas of improvement and ensure a certain level of quality, it can also stifle creativity and individuality. Every student is unique, and their learning journeys should reflect that diversity.

Overreliance on AI-driven curricula and assessments can lead to a one-size-fits-all approach to education, where students are expected to conform to pre-determined standards and expectations. This can discourage critical thinking, problem-solving, and creativity, as students may become more focused on “teaching to the test” rather than exploring their own interests and passions.

5. Job Displacement for Educators

As AI technologies become more advanced, there is a growing fear that they may replace human educators. While AI can assist teachers in various ways, such as automating administrative tasks and providing personalized feedback, it cannot fully replace the nuanced and complex roles that educators play.

The displacement of human educators by AI could result in job losses and undermine the profession. Moreover, it could deprive students of the mentorship, inspiration, and guidance that only human teachers can provide. The role of educators should evolve alongside AI, focusing on activities that require emotional intelligence, creativity, and ethical guidance.

6. Inequality in Access

AI-powered education tools require access to technology and the internet. Unfortunately, not all students have equal access to these resources. The digital divide is a significant barrier to equitable education, as students from lower-income backgrounds or underserved communities may not have the necessary devices or internet connectivity.

The adoption of AI in education could exacerbate these inequalities. Students who do not have access to AI-driven learning tools may be left at a disadvantage compared to their peers who do. This could further widen the achievement gap and perpetuate educational inequalities.

7. Dependency and Reduced Critical Thinking

While AI can provide answers and solutions quickly, it may inadvertently discourage students from developing critical thinking skills. When students become overly reliant on AI for information and problem-solving, they may not learn how to think critically, analyze information, or solve complex problems on their own.

Additionally, the algorithms behind AI-driven content recommendations may create filter bubbles, where students are exposed only to information and viewpoints that align with their existing beliefs and preferences. This can hinder their ability to engage with diverse perspectives and think critically about complex issues.

8. Ethical Considerations

The ethical implications of AI in education are complex and multifaceted. AI systems must be designed and used ethically to ensure fair and just outcomes for all students. This includes addressing issues related to bias, privacy, transparency, and accountability.

There is also the ethical dilemma of using AI for surveillance and monitoring of students, as it raises questions about consent and autonomy. The decisions made by AI algorithms, such as those related to admissions or scholarships, can have life-changing consequences for students, making it imperative that these systems operate fairly and transparently.
